Rags are a good idea.  Anything from dusting furniture and waxing the car to cleaning windows.  Keep some in the garage and use them as rags for checking the oil in your car engine or wiping down the lawn mower after cutting the grass.  If you really want to get devious, use them as packing material in a box when you have to wrap up a birthday or Christmas gift for a friend or relative.
